Here's the thing ~ most any big store, etc, is going to have a VERIFIED Facebook page. If the page saying they're giving away whatever isn't verified, 99% of the time it's bogus.

I once read a great article explaining these kinds of ads and offers. the people behind them purposely make them outrageously stupid or hard to believe. that's because they want to weed out the logical, rational people who know it is BS or that it's a scam. who they want are the truly gullible or stupid people who will fall for anything. those are the easy marks. they will believe anything and will part with their money easily. that's who those ads are targeted towards.
